Virginia SB 1270 (2017) — Ohio River Basin Commission; repeals sections relating to participation by the Commonwealth.
Repeals two sections of the Code of Virginia relating to the participation by the Commonwealth in the Ohio River Basin Commission. The Commission, established by federal executive order in 1971, was terminated by executive order in 1981. This bill is a recommendation of the Virginia Code Commission.
